How much does it cost to use foodstand?

Browsing and discovering makers is completely free. You pay the maker directly for what you order — there are no marked-up prices or hidden delivery fees baked in.

Where does the food come from?

Every maker is a real local person or independent business — home bakers, batch cooks, allotment growers, beekeepers and family-run farm shops. We show you their location as a coarse outcode so you know roughly how near they are.

Is homemade food safe?

Makers are responsible for registering with their local council and following food-hygiene rules, and many display allergen information on every dish. We make allergens and dietary tags clear so you can shop with confidence.

Can I sell my own food?

Yes — if you bake, cook, grow or preserve, you can create a free maker profile, list your dishes and start taking orders from people nearby in minutes.
